PERSONALITIES OF THE BRITISH EMPIRE
Interesting lot of 15 signed items in various formats by well known personalities of the British Empire during the eighteenth and nineteenth centuries, includes: SIR EVAN NEPEAN A.L.S., 1p. 4to., Nov. 26, 1816, Bombay, as Governor, making an appointment, in part: "...if Capt. Anderson can refrain from lifting his hand too often to his head, he will find it a comfortable provision 'till he gets the rank of major..."; CAROLINE de BOURBON A.N.S. 12 mo., [n.p., n.d.], inquiring about an article that appeared in the journal gazette by Theodore Muret; JOHN CUST free frank "Brownlow"; ARTHUR WELLESLEY PEEL, admittance ticket allowing the bearer into the Gallery of the House of Commons, with scarce full signature; GEORGE SUTHERLAND-LEVESON-GOWER, important A.L.S., 2pp. 4to., House of Lords, May 11, 1832, in part: "…..praying that the reform bill (Scotland) is passed unmutilated ….that if the expectations which these petitioners and thousands had entertained were unfortunately doomed to be again disappointed….the greatest and most obvious evil of the present system would in the first place be removed by the disfranchisement of the nomination 'Boroughs'; SIR HOWARD DOUGLAS A.L.S.,1. 8vo., Apr. 11, 1861, sending best wishes to a fellow Member of Parliament who served in 1842; JAMES CAMPBELL A.Ms. unsigned, 1p. 12mo., Headquarters, Halifax, Aug. 6, 1786, in part: "…..I am commanded by General Campbell to transmit you eight copies of the Royal General Regulations and Orders for his Majesty's Forces, requiring strict conformity and obedience…". Also included: a large group of signed and mounted free frank cover fronts, letters and documents, affixed to both sides of 4to. album sheets, the majority dated between 1820 and 1832, by well known personalities of the British Empire, including: MARBOROUGH, ABERDEEN, DRINKWATER, ERSKINE, BARHAM, STANHOPE, SUSSEX, E.B. CLIVE, FRANCIS CHANTREY, LADY GREY, JOSEPH HUME, S. LICHFIELD, T. HEREFORD, CARLISLE, ALBANANTE, P.R. COCKS, PALMER, T. HAWKES, ROBERT PRICE, DEVONSHIRE, MARSFIELD, NOTHHAM, LAKES, CLARENDON, CHATHAM, CARRINGTON, C.H. CHARLES, GRATTON, MUNSTER, LORD STOWELL and many more! Should be examined, overall very good.
